 By: Bolton H.B. No. 4449


 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
 AN ACT
 relating to the criminal consequences of operating a motorcycle on
 which a person younger than five is a passenger.
 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
 SECTION 1. Section 545.416, Transportation Code, is amended
 by adding Subsection (d) to read as follows:
 (d)  An operator may not carry another person on a motorcycle
 unless the other person is at least five years of age. An offense
 under this subsection is a misdemeanor punishable by a fine of not
 less than $100 or more than $200. It is a defense to prosecution
 under this subsection that the operator was operating the
 motorcycle in an emergency or for a law enforcement purpose.
 SECTION 2. The change in law made by this Act applies only
 to an offense committed on or after the effective date of this Act.
 An offense committed before the effective date of this Act is
 governed by the law in effect when the offense was committed, and
 the former law is continued in effect for that purpose. For
 purposes of this section, an offense was committed before the
 effective date of this Act if any element of the offense was
 committed before that date.
 SECTION 3. This Act takes effect September 1, 2009.
